This interstate route from Fresno, California to South Bend, Indiana spans over 1,800 miles, requiring careful planning for timing, cost, and logistics to ensure a smooth relocation experience.
The estimated distance of 1,816 miles is based on the most direct driving route between Fresno and South Bend.
This is an interstate move because it crosses state lines from California to Indiana.
Drive times are limited by safety regulations and practical scheduling, typically resulting in a 3 to 4 day delivery window.

Expect moving costs from Fresno to South Bend to vary based on the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,771 to $1,862, medium moves from $2,037 to $2,141, and large moves from $2,302 to $2,421.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Comparing quotes ensures you find a service that fits your budget and needs.

The most affordable option is typically a self-service move where you pack and load your belongings, and the company handles transportation. Full-service moves with packing and unpacking are more costly but offer convenience.
Booking several weeks in advance can secure better pricing and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ons like summer to reduce costs and ensure timely service.
Yes, interstate movers must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to operate legally across state lines, ensuring compliance and consumer protection.
Plan for transit time, coordinate delivery dates, consider storage needs if any, and confirm the moving company’s insurance and licensing. Clear communication helps avoid delays and unexpected costs.
